Is the following sentence correct?

"A Position in a results oriented company, which seeks an ambitious and career conscious person whose acquired skills are utilized towards continued growth and advancement."

The first part is a phrase, and the second part just contains two dependent clauses introduced by two pronouns 'which' and 'whose'. It is an incomplete sentence.
